Ranchi is preparing to host the Rath Yatra of Lord Jagannath on June 27. Lord Jagannath, accompanied by his siblings, will travel on a chariot to Mausi Badi. The Jagannathpur Temple Committee and the district administration are working diligently on the preparations. The fair associated with the Rath Yatra is also taking shape, with swings and stalls being erected for the nine-day event. The Rath Yatra traditionally begins on the Dwitiya Tithi of the Shukla Paksha in the month of Ashadha and concludes on Ekadashi Tithi. Thousands participate in pulling the chariot of Lord Jagannath over the ten-day period. Devotees also visit the fair, enjoy the festivities, and buy goods. The Jagannath fair will culminate on July 6th, coinciding with Devshayani Ekadashi. The final day of the Yatra is known as Ghurti Rath Yatra.
